The lenses for the IMX219 and other mobile-use sensors were developed using materials optimized for the MTF of its 1.12 µm pixels.
M12 lenses, on the other hand, are typically designed with MTF characteristics suitable for 2–2.9 µm pixels, so replacing the lens may actually reduce sharpness.
In general, it is difficult to find C-Mount or M12 lenses specifically designed for 1.12 µm pixels, so it is necessary to use lenses designed for the HQ camera (1/2.3") with a 12-megapixel resolution.
Since the HQ camera has the same optical format and pixel count as GoPro, it is possible to find replacement M12 lenses for it.
